Visqueen (black plastic) and spray adhesive if the holes are not over 6ft in diameter.
Wipe off area with rag, spray adhesive on patch and existing belly skin, let tack up for about 30 seconds and install.

Before buying measure width of opening and check top of existing hood and compare to vent opening of new hood.
You may need a transition fitting from rectangular to round. If rectangular pick up dampener . Make sure it opens before securing hood in place.
Hood should be rated 90cfm.

Install as much un faced insulation in contact with floor sheeting as possible in joist bays. Before installing insulation seal/foam all holes/penetrations of floor sheeting elec,plmg and around heat duct. Seal all joints of duct work with duct mastic.
